The Syncro temp gauge sensor is the same one used on the 1.9L Vanagons. So is the screw in Temp 2 sensor for the ECU. Dennis

I looked for a syncro vanagon part that many parts places would have trouble getting right. it's the single contact screw-in Temp Sensor for the temo gauge .. any year syncro vanagon ( I just used 1987 ) .. syncro's have aluminum thermostat housings...not the plastic one 2WD 2.1 wbxr vanagons have .. and their gauge sensor is screw-in, not push in a hole with an o-ring and then insert a clip like 2WD 2.1 wbxr vanagons have. if anyone wants to.. see if you can find an aluminum Syncro Vanagon with 2.1 wbxr engine t-stat housing, and then the screw in singe contact sensor for the gauge. so far I don't see it. and then ....I see a diesel engine and a wbxr engine shown in the same diagram .. trying to get t-stat housings and sensors for more than one type of engine, in one picture.
